Transaction 36686869f554ff45e2b671b14e707ea682e2e154880e98aabc6933707124d2e8
1 Input
1 Output
-
36686869f554ff45e2b671b14e707ea682e2e154880e98aabc6933707124d2e8:0
- value
- 631226
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ce5488751980aeaeea9d03acaf5541dd37026cf OP_EQUAL
- address
- 3D5QPDQb95NXhFRSGNm8skQrcnnLVp2jwu